7-Day Bali Honeymoon Itinerary

Tuesday, November 28: Arrival in Bali

Welcome to Bali! Start your romantic honeymoon by checking into your luxurious beachfront resort. Take some time to relax, unwind, and enjoy the stunning views of the Indian Ocean. In the afternoon, explore the nearby Jimbaran Bay and indulge in a romantic candlelit dinner on the beach. Wrap up the day with a leisurely evening stroll along the shore.

  • Check-in at a beachfront resort: Check prices and availability
  • Jimbaran Bay: Enjoy a romantic dinner on the beach
Wednesday, November 29: Ubud Exploration

Embark on a cultural and nature-filled day trip to Ubud, Bali's cultural heart. Start your morning by visiting the iconic Ubud Monkey Forest and get up close and personal with playful monkeys and lush greenery. In the afternoon, explore the traditional art market for unique souvenirs and handmade crafts. End the day with a romantic walk through the picturesque Tegalalang Rice Terraces.

  • Ubud Monkey Forest: Entrance fee - $5,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Ubud Traditional Art Market: Free entry,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Tegalalang Rice Terraces: Free entry, Time spent - 1-2 hours
Thursday, November 30: Waterfall Adventure

Embark on a day full of adventure and natural beauty as you visit Bali's stunning waterfalls. Start your morning by trekking to the majestic Gitgit Waterfall in the north of Bali. Enjoy the refreshing waters and take memorable photos. In the afternoon, head to the enchanting Tegenungan Waterfall near Ubud and take a dip in the crystal-clear pool. Spend the evening relaxing at your resort.

  • Gitgit Waterfall: Entrance fee - $1,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Tegenungan Waterfall: Entrance fee - $2, Time spent - 1-2 hours
Friday, December 1: Sunrise Volcano Trek

Rise early for an unforgettable sunrise trek to the summit of Mount Batur. Start your hike in the dark and reach the top just in time to witness the breathtaking sunrise over the surrounding landscapes. After descending, visit the nearby hot springs for a relaxing soak. Spend the evening enjoying a romantic dinner at your resort.

  • Mount Batur Sunrise Trek: Tour cost - $50 per person, Time spent - 8-10 hours
  • Toya Devasya Hot Springs: Entrance fee - $20,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Saturday, December 2: Island Hopping and Beach Relaxation

Embark on an island-hopping adventure to explore Bali's pristine neighboring islands. Start with a visit to Nusa Lembongan, where you can snorkel in crystal-clear waters and relax on white sandy beaches. In the afternoon, head to Nusa Penida and visit the iconic Kelingking Beach, known for its incredible views. Return to your resort in the evening for a romantic sunset by the beach.

  • Nusa Lembongan: Boat trip cost - $50 per person, Time spent - Full day
  • Kelingking Beach: Free entry,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Sunday, December 3: Cultural Immersion in Tanah Lot

Immerse yourselves in Bali's rich cultural heritage with a visit to the iconic Tanah Lot Temple. Explore the temple complex and marvel at its stunning oceanfront location. Enjoy a traditional Balinese dance performance and witness a spectacular sunset over the temple. In the evening, indulge in a romantic dinner at a beachside restaurant.

  • Tanah Lot Temple: Entrance fee - $3,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Balinese dance performance: Ticket cost - $10, Time spent - 1 hour
Monday, December 4: Relaxation and Spa Retreat

Take a day to unwind and pamper yourselves with a relaxing spa retreat. Enjoy a couple's massage and rejuvenating spa treatments at one of Bali's renowned wellness centers. Spend the rest of the day lounging by the pool or exploring the nearby beaches. In the evening, savor a romantic candlelit dinner at your resort.

  • Spa retreat: Cost varies depending on the choice of spa, Time spent - Half-day

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a more off the beaten path experience, consider visiting the hidden gem of Sidemen, a peaceful village surrounded by lush rice terraces and traditional Balinese culture. Explore the scenic countryside, take a bicycle ride through the villages, and unwind in the quiet ambiance. Another local favorite is the lesser-known beach of Nyang Nyang, known for its pristine white sands and turquoise waters. Enjoy a secluded beach day away from the crowds.
